在现代应用程序和网站中,数据库扮演着至关重要的角色。无论是存储用户信息、产品数据还是交易记录,获取和管理这些信息都是开发和维护工作的重要组成部分。本文将为您提供从数据库中获取信息的详细步骤和技巧,帮助您有 数据库到数据 效地提取所需的数据。
一、了解数据库
在深入探讨如何从数据库获取信息之前,首先需要了解数据库的基本概念。数据库是一个系统化存储和管理数据的集合,通常使用结构化查询语言(SQL)进行交互。常见的数据库管理系统包括 MySQL、PostgreSQL、Oracle 和 Microsoft SQL Server 等。
二、选择合适的工具
获取数据库信息的第一步是选择适当的工具。以下是一些常用的数据库管理工具:
- 命令行界面:对于熟悉 SQL 的用户,可以使用命令行工具直接与数据库交互。
- 图形用户界面(GUI)工具:如 MyS 购买越南电子邮件地址 QL Workbench、pgAdmin 或 SQL Server Management Studio,这些工具提供了
- 编程语言:许多编程语言(如 Python、Java、PHP 等)提供了数据库连接库,可以通过代码从数据库中获取信息。
三、连接到数据
在获取信息之前,首先需要连接到数据库。以下是使用 Python fr 数字 和 MySQL 的示例代码:
的数据库连接信息。
四、编写查询语句
连接成功后,您可以编写 SQL 查询语句来获取所需信息。以下是一些常见的 SQL 查询示例:
1. 查询所有记录
要从某个表中获取所有记录,可以下语句:
如果您只需要特定的列,可以这样写:
s
3. 添加条件筛选
例如,如果要获取所有年龄大于 18 岁的用户信息,可以使用:
sql
五、执行查询
使用游标(cursor)对象执行查询并获
获取到的数据通常是以列表或字典的形式存储,您可以根据需要进行处理。例如,可以将结果转换为 JSON 格式,以便在前端应用中使用:
完成数据获取后,别忘了关闭游标和数据库连接,以释放资源:
- 优化查询:确保您的查询是高效的,避免使用
SELECT *
,尽量选择必要的列。 - 使用索引:在数据库中使用索引可以显著提高查询速度,尤其是在处理大量数据时。
- 安全性:避免 SQL 注入攻击,使用参数化查询或 ORM(对象关系映射)库来增强安全性
从数据库获取信息的过程涉及多个步骤,包括连接到数据库、编写和执行查询以及处理结果。通过掌握这些技能,您能够有效地管理和利用数据库中的数据,提升应用程序的性能和用户体验。希望本文提供的指南能够帮助您在数据库操作中更加得心应手,轻松获取所需的信息!